'THE AZAD JAMMU AND KASHMIR 'THE AZAD JAMMU AND KASHMIR COURTS AND LAWS CODE, 1949 CHAPTER-III SUBORDINATE CIVIL COURTS 37. Power to transfer cases. (1) A District Judge may transfer any appeal pending before him from the decrees or orders of Subordinate Judges to any other Subordinate Judge under his administrative control competent to dispose it of. (2) The District Judge may withdraw any appeal so transferred and either hear and dispose it of himself or transfer it to a Court, under his administrative control, competent to dispose it of. (3) Appeals transferred under this section shall be disposed of subject to the rules applicable to like appeals when disposed of by the District Judge.
